Drugs valued at £100,000 recovered from Cardonald, Glasgow

Officers in Glasgow have seized controlled drugs worth around £100,000.

On Saturday, 8 February 2025, officers acting on intelligence searched a property in Tarfside Oval, Cardonald, recovering cannabis with a street value in the region of £100,000.

A 41-year-old man was arrested and charged in connection with this recovery. He is due to appear at Glasgow Sheriff Court on Monday, 10 February, 2025.

​Inspector Kaeren Muir said: "We are determined to protect the public from harmful criminality by disrupting sale of illegal substances and preventing them from being circulated on the streets of our community.
